Smart Sorting Equipments



Executing wise sorting systems transforms rubbish collection by simplifying the process and boosting efficiency. These systems use sophisticated modern technology to instantly sort recyclables from basic waste, decreasing contamination degrees and raising the quantity of product that can be recycled. By incorporating sensing units and expert system, smart sorting systems can determine various types of products, such as plastics, glass, and paper, with remarkable accuracy.

With the ability to different materials at the resource, smart sorting systems make reusing more convenient for individuals and companies alike. By enhancing the quality of recyclables gathered, these systems add to a much more sustainable waste administration procedure.

Additionally, the information gathered from these systems can aid districts track reusing prices, determine fads, and enhance collection courses.

Waste-to-Energy Technologies



With waste generation increasing, discovering sustainable solutions is coming to be significantly important. Waste-to-Energy (WtE) modern technologies use an encouraging technique to managing our waste while generating power. These modern technologies involve converting non-recyclable waste products into functional kinds of energy like electrical power, warmth, or gas.



By drawing away waste from garbage dumps and blazing it in regulated setups, WtE not just reduces the volume of waste but likewise generates useful energy resources.

One usual technique of WtE is mass-burn incineration, where waste is melted at heats to create vapor that drives wind turbines creating power. One more strategy is gasification, which transforms waste into synthetic gas that can be made use of for power generation or as a chemical feedstock.

Furthermore, anaerobic food digestion breaks down organic waste to create biogas for power.

Applying WtE technologies can help in reducing greenhouse gas exhausts, decrease reliance on fossil fuels, and decrease the environmental impact of garbage disposal.
